What they do
An Accounts Payable or Receivable Clerk keeps records of accounts and financial transactions, with specific responsibility for Accounts Payable/Receivable. Works for a business or bookkeeping service. Provides information for financial and tax reports completed by an accountant.

full-time Accounts Receivable Specialist We're looking for an experienced AR professional to own the full receivables cycle for a growing organization - from collections and credit risk to reconciliations and month-end close. This is a contract-to-direct-hire opportunity, with strong performers converted to a permanent role. You'll manage a $1M+ active AR portfolio, assess credit risk on new and existing accounts, and serve as a key partner to sales and finance in keeping cash flow healthy. What You'll Do Collections Own a $1M+ AR portfolio, driving consistent client follow-up on outstanding balances Track aging reports and get ahead of delinquent accounts Negotiate payment plans and document all collection activity Resolve billing discrepancies alongside sales and operations Apply cash receipts accurately in Sage Intacct Credit & Risk Evaluate credit applications and assess financial risk for new and existing customers Review financial statements, credit reports, and payment history to recommend credit limits and terms Monitor active credit lines for exposure and flag risk early Help shape and enforce internal credit policy Reconciliations & Close Reconcile AR to ensure ledger accuracy Prepare and review AR aging schedules Support month-end close (journal entries, reporting) and audit documentation What You Bring 4+ years of progressive AR experience, including credit analysis/risk assessment Experience managing $1M+ in collections Background in distribution, wholesale, or lending preferred Sage Intacct proficiency strongly preferred Solid grasp of reconciliations and month-end close Confident, firm communicator who can hold tough collection conversations Sharp, analytical, detail-driven
